AP Exams 2025: Unlock College Credit and Global Opportunities

Advanced Placement (AP) Exams are globally recognized standardized tests conducted by the College Board for high school students (Grades 9–12). These exams are designed to help ambitious students showcase their academic excellence, gain advanced placement in universities, and even earn direct college credit while still in school. AP scores are valued by top universities in the U.S., Canada, the UK, Australia, and India, making them a powerful tool for students aiming to study abroad or in prestigious institutions at home.

Scoring well in AP Exams not only strengthens college applications but also saves valuable time and money by allowing students to skip introductory-level courses in college. With subjects spanning STEM, Humanities, and Social Sciences, AP provides a unique opportunity to accelerate education, stand out in competitive admissions, and prepare for the academic challenges of higher studies on a global scale.

What Subjects are Offered in AP?

Advanced Placement (AP) Exams cover a wide range of subjects across major academic disciplines:

STEM

Science, Technology, Engineering, Mathematics

AP Calculus AB & BC
AP Physics 1, 2, and C
AP Chemistry
AP Biology
AP Computer Science A
AP Computer Science Principles
AP Statistics
Humanities

Language, Literature, History

AP English Language and Composition
AP English Literature and Composition
AP Art History
AP World History
AP European History
AP Comparative Government & Politics
AP Human Geography
Social Sciences & Business

Economics, Psychology, Civics

AP Macroeconomics
AP Microeconomics
AP Psychology
AP U.S. Government & Politics
AP U.S. History
